I have a question, I'm using Google sheets instead of Excel but I heard most of the syntax is the same: I have this formula =FIND(B1, A2, 1) pasted in each cell of an entire column When I paste it in each, it automatically adjusts the A2 to be the cell next to where I'm putting the function. However, it also changes B1 depending on which cell I paste the function in. Is there a way for me to prevent it from changing the B1 value, so it stays B1 no matter which cell I paste it in?
@DaveOnData3 жыл бұрын
I've never used Google Sheets, but in Excel this is easy enough to do: =FIND($B$1, A2, 1)
